titleOfInvention A kind of human MUC1 specific binding polypeptide and its extraction method
abstract The invention discloses a human MUCl specific binding polypeptide, the amino acid sequence of which is HKFIPHRDTSIA. The polypeptide is verified by methods such as biopanning, amplification of positive phage, DNA sequence determination of the polypeptide encoded by the phage, and ELISA assay on the screened positive phage. The polypeptide has small molecular weight, easy chemical synthesis, low immunogenicity, can specifically bind to human MUC1 protein, and has good application value in the field of tumor diagnosis and treatment targeting human MUC1 protein.
